Mission Statement

Sea Save Foundation stands witness to the health of the oceans and the threats they face, we document problems and develop solutions, arm people with knowledge, and tools so they can make a difference. With the public as our ally, we go to the United Nations and other global bodies to effect international change. We attend these meetings so we can offer creative, economically viable, sustainable, and environmentally friendly plans to decision-makers. We also make sure everyone is doing their best to meet their targets.

Description

Sea Save Foundation approaches conservation from two fronts:

  1. We develop and promote inspiring educational campaigns that showcase the beauty of ocean flora and fauna and underscore the current challenges facing our marine ecosystems.
  2. We couple serious environmental issues with concrete advocacy campaigns undertaken by our supporters and partners. With these programs, we hope to raise awareness about the importance of ocean conservation and create sustainable, healthy ecosystems for generations to come. It’s your ocean. Do something about it!
